Transaction bc626fb308690072897474b14fc90474ab0377b86f2c42216b9de69c6f3cadb8
1 Input
1 Output
-
bc626fb308690072897474b14fc90474ab0377b86f2c42216b9de69c6f3cadb8:0
- value
- 28152
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d82039a86c85b4fa3e57ae6d62bd2a253f82f73a0a3ff9366b0d10bb0a8f2cd9
- address
- bc1pmqsrn2rvsk6050jh4ekk90f2y5lc9ae6pglljdntp5gtkz509nvsajlkgt